Hey ladies! I am a facial product junkie!
I just wanted to share my new love.........of a product!!
I have always been good about taking care of my skin. I always wash, exfoliate, moisturize, etc. And I have used everything from Noxzema and Swiss Formula to Clinique, Estee Lauder, etc....and other department store brands.
Well, I have been using the Garnier Nutritoniste brand for the last month or so and am extremely happy with the results! It's not the cheapest line but not near as expensive as department store brands and it lasts a long time because you need a tiny bit.
But I can honestly say I can see and feel a huge difference in my skin tone. It feels SO soft and has evened out a lot. If I had to choose only one of these items, it would definitely be the Skin Renew Anti Sun-Damage daily moisture lotion. It has a SPF of 28 I think it is. Great great product!
I use the:
Nutri-Pure Microbead Cream Scrub (oil free)
Skin Renew Anti-Sun Damage daily moisture lotion (LOVE this stuff!!!)
Ultra-Life anti-wrinkle firming night cream
and
Skin Renew Anti-Puff Eye Roller Gel (COOL product!)
Just wanted to share!!!! :bigsmile:
